在设计数据表用户界面(UI)时,目标是创建一个既直观又高效的用户体验。以下五大原则可以帮助你提升软件的易用性和效率:
原则一:清晰的结构与布局
主题句:一个清晰的结构和布局对于用户快速找到所需信息至关重要。
- 使用网格布局:确保数据表中的列和行整齐排列,使信息易于阅读和理解。
- 合理的列宽:根据数据内容调整列宽,避免过窄导致信息丢失,或过宽造成空间浪费。
- 分组和层次:对于复杂的数据表,使用分组和层次结构来组织信息,帮助用户理解数据的组织方式。
例子:
| 列1 | 列2 | 列3 | 列4 |
| --- | --- | --- | --- |
| 数据1 | 数据2 | 数据3 | 数据4 |
| 数据5 | 数据6 | 数据7 | 数据8 |
原则二:直观的交互元素
主题句:交互元素的设计应直观,以便用户能够快速理解如何与数据表互动。
- 使用常见的图标和按钮:例如,删除、编辑和搜索图标应遵循标准设计,以便用户能够快速识别。
- 保持一致性:在所有数据表中使用相同的交互元素和设计模式,减少用户的学习成本。
例子:
[删除] [编辑] [搜索]
原则三:高效的筛选和排序功能
主题句:提供强大的筛选和排序功能,使用户能够快速定位和比较数据。
- 筛选选项:提供多种筛选选项,如按日期、类别、状态等筛选。
- 排序功能:允许用户根据不同列对数据进行排序。
例子:
筛选:
- 按日期
- 按类别
- 按状态
排序:
- 列1 升序
- 列1 降序
原则四:合理的分页机制
主题句:分页设计应合理,避免信息过载,同时保持数据访问的便捷性。
- 适当的页数:根据数据量和用户需求确定合适的页数。
- 导航控件:提供向前、向后和跳转页面的控件,使用户能够轻松浏览。
例子:
当前页:1/10
[上一页] [下一页] [跳转到]
原则五:响应式设计
主题句:确保数据表在不同设备和屏幕尺寸上都能良好显示。
- 响应式布局:使用媒体查询等技术,确保数据表在不同屏幕尺寸上都能正确显示。
- 触摸友好:在移动设备上优化交互元素的大小和布局,使其易于触摸。
例子:
| 列1 | 列2 | 列3 | 列4 |
| --- | --- | --- | --- |
| 数据1 | 数据2 | 数据3 | 数据4 |
| 数据5 | 数据6 | 数据7 | 数据8 |
通过遵循上述五大原则,你可以设计出既美观又实用的数据表UI,从而提升软件的整体易用性和效率。
